Is it possible to do a project search, but see the complete binder, with the documents highlighted in which your search term shows up? This instead of a filtered binder.
This would make it much easier to see where in a long document (like my 240K novel) the search term appears.

thanks. yeah, that i know. but it’s like if your search result turns up in say 5 documents out of 50, it would be great to see where, in one view.
- Do the search.
- Click a file in the search result/binder.
- Select all of the search result (Ctrl-A)
- Reveal in binder.
If you turn the search result into a collection (between step 3 and 4), you’ll be able to go back and forth.
